Alison Braden is a talented water polo player from Canada. She was born in Calgary, Alberta, on November 26, 1982. Alison has represented her country in major international competitions.

Alison Braden's Water Polo Journey
Playing in College
Alison played water polo for California State University, Long Beach. She was part of their women's team from 2003 to 2005. During her time there, she played in 92 games. She also made 96 assists, which means she helped her teammates score many goals.
Representing Canada
Alison was an important member of the Canadian national women's water polo team. This team achieved great success in 2007. They won a silver medal at the Pan American Games. These games took place in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il.
Commonwealth Championships Success
Before the Pan American Games, Alison also competed in the Commonwealth Water Polo Championships. In 2006, her team won a silver medal at the championships held in Perth. This showed her strong commitment to the sport.
